Friday, November 27th, 2009A wonderful winter compilation from a great little label – Bladen county records. A Moveable feast (named after the set of memoires of E. Hemingway) is a very unique and interesting collection of songs. It was zipped on my desktop for awhile and I have just extracted it and the timing is perfect. It is Friday afternoon and the Sabbath came in and its all so quite around here, and the songs are so touching and beautiful.
This are some real good songs from bunch of artists and friends of this label. Artists such as Ritchie Young, Team Evil, Alan Singley and Blue horns. My favorites of this record are ‘Jeremy Frank’ by Team evil,’ Feet of lead’ by Oh captain my captain, ‘Whalebelly’ by Autopilot – a unique sounding waltz (listen to it below), A great little song be Sean Finn, and an awesome last tune by Alan Singley – ‘Rice Pudding.
